The Sun Hydraulics PVFBCWN (PVFBCWN) is a ventable, pilot-operated pressure reducing/relieving valve designed to reduce a high primary pressure at the inlet to a constant reduced pressure at port 1, while also providing full-flow relief from port 1 to tank port 3. This valve features a vent port (port 4) that allows for remote control through pilot or two-way valves. The pressure at port 3 is directly additive to the valve setting in a 1:1 ratio and should not exceed 3000 psi (210 bar). The valve is capable of handling maximum inlet pressures determined by its adjustment range, with certain ranges tested up to 5000 psi (350 bar). It exhibits very low deadband transition between reducing and relieving modes, exceptionally flat pressure-flow characteristics, stability, and low hysteresis. The valve allows for full reverse flow from reduced pressure port 1 to inlet port 2; however, this may cause the main spool to close unless an additional check valve is included in the circuit. By managing the vent port pressure, users can control the effective setting of the valve below its nominal value. It incorporates Sun's floating style construction to minimize internal binding due to excessive installation torque or variations in cavity/cartridge machining. The PVFBCWN has a capacity of 20 gpm (80 L/min) and operates with maximum pressures up to 5000 psi (350 bar). Adjustments are made via an internal hex screw, with specific torque requirements for installation and locknut adjustments. This model weighs approximately .70 lb (.30 kg) and utilizes Viton seals for durability under various conditions.

Ventable, pilot-operated pressure reducing/relieving valves reduce a high primary pressure at the inlet to a constant reduced pressure at port 1, with a full-flow relief function from port 1 to tank (port 3). The vent port (port 4) can be used as a means for remote control by pilot or 2-way valves.
- Pressure at port 3 is directly additive to the valve setting at a 1:1 ratio and should not exceed 3000 psi (210 bar).
- Pilot operated valves exhibit very low dead-band transition between reducing and relieving modes.
- Recommended maximum inlet pressure is determined by the adjustment range. Ranges D, E, N, and Q are tested with a 2000 psi (140 bar) maximum differential between inlet and reduced pressure. Ranges A, B, and H are tested with a 3000 psi (210 bar) maximum differential between inlet and reduced pressure. Ranges C and W are tested with 5000 psi (350 bar) of inlet pressure.
- Pilot operated valves exhibit exceptionally flat pressure/flow characteristics, are very stable and have low hysteresis.
- Full reverse flow from reduced pressure (port 1) to inlet (port 2) may cause the main spool to close. If reverse free flow is required in the circuit, consider adding a separate check valve to the circuit.
- By controlling the pressure at the vent (port 4), the effective setting of the valve can be controlled below the nominal valve setting.
- Incorporates the Sun floating style construction to minimize the possibility of internal parts binding due to excessive installation torque and/or cavity/cartridge machining variations.
| Cavity | T-22A |
| Series | 2 |
| Capacity | 20 gpm80 L/min. |
| Factory Pressure Settings Established at | blocked control port (dead headed)blocked control port (dead headed) |
| Maximum Operating Pressure | 5000 psi350 bar |
| Control Pilot Flow | 10 - 15 in³/min.0,16 - 0,25 L/min. |
| Adjustment - Number of Clockwise Turns to Increase Setting | 55 |
| Valve Hex Size | 1 1/8 in.28,6 mm |
| Valve Installation Torque | 45 - 50 lbf ft61 - 68 Nm |
| Adjustment Screw Internal Hex Size | 5/32 in.4 mm |
| Locknut Hex Size | 9/16 in.15 mm |
| Locknut Torque | 80 - 90 lbf in.9 - 10 Nm |
| Model Weight | .70 lb0,30 kg |
| Seal kit - Cartridge | Viton: 990-022-006 |
